Gaiam TV Fit & Yoga is a home workout app designed to help users with their yoga practice where ever they are.
But is Gaiam TV the right investment for you?
Gaiam TV is best for users 16+ years of age who want home workouts where ever they go. Presented by some of the biggest names in fitness, Gaiam’s video content is clear and informative. However, it lacks personalisation, making it feel more like a fitness video player rather than a fitness app.

| About Gaiam TV
Gaiam TV is a home workout, Yoga and fitness app presented by renowned instructors like Tony Horton (P90x), Rodney Yee (godfather of Gaiam Yoga), and Ashleigh Sergeant (The yogini behind “Yoga is Easier Than You Think”).
The app offers a wide range of fitness content so users can browse for the right content to suit their needs and health and wellness goals.
With classes and series covering other forms of exercises such as foam rolling, HIIT, bodyweight training and barre, there is something to suit everyone. And best of all it can be done on your own schedule, in your own space.

| Is Gaiam TV Any Good?
Gaiam TV Fit & Yoga is a solid home workout fitness app that gives users the ability to train anywhere at any time.
The platform brings users high-quality training videos from some of the industry’s biggest names, like Tony Horton (P90x) and Ashleigh Sergeant.
However, its lack of depth and overall function leave the app feeling bare, making it not worth the price tag.
| How Much Does Gaiam TV Cost?
A 1-month subscription costs $6.99, which works out to be $1.75 per week. A 12-month subscription costs $69.99, which works out to be $5.83 per month.
Gaiam TV Fit & Yoga is free to download from the App Store (iOS) and Play Store (Android). Gaiam TV offers new users a 7-day free trial.

| Gaiam TV Positives
Layout
Gaiam TV is well presented and has a simple and effective layout.
The moment you open users will quickly understand the menu system and user interface.
Headings and icons are clear and sessions are complete with helpful descriptions for easy navigation.
Video Content
Gaiam TV’s video content is its strong suit.
All videos are high quality both in format and in presentation, as the high profile industry professional guides you through workouts, recipes and series.
To further elevate this all videos can be streamed to other supported devices with the use of Apple’s AirPlay and casting to Chromecast and smart TV.
This is a great function as it allows users to enlarge their training experience where ever they go. Increasing immersions, and engagement.
| Gaiam TV Negatives
Limited Functions
Gaiam TV Fit & Yoga offers limited function outside of its video content.
The app’s simple interface and navigation while one of its strengths, is also sadly a reflection of the lack of content to fill the tab provided.
With all the app’s star power, it would be great to see trainer profiles added as they would allow users to search for their favourite instructor while flexing the platform’s expertise, and improving credibility.
Basic functions such as search tags featured, workouts and recommendations could also be implemented to help give users some direction.
This function while simple is essential as not all users know what they want or better yet what they need from their training.
Empty Tabs
Browsing through the apps, it’s clear there is little content to warrant the additional tabs.
Upon opening both the ‘Search’ and ‘Library’ tabs, you are presented with empty tabs with nothing more than some basic instructions.
There is not enough function or content to warrant one, let alone two entire tabs here. This leaves the back end of the application feeling empty and unbalancing the overall flow of the app.
Search tabs require recommendations such as top workouts, tags, or categories, especially for new users. This gives users an idea of what is on offer and what to search for.
The library function also suffers from this issue as it has no content until the user fills it.
The library could simply be absorbed into either the search tab or to the explore pages as a sub-tab or menu option. helping to fill out the app and improving functionality.
No Personalisation
Gaiam TV offers no personalisation and little to no profile features.
These are essential components in today’s fitness market as they make sure feel like they are a part of a bigger experience.
By getting news users to set their personal preferences and goal, the app would immediately let the user know that the app is about them and their needs.
Providing these functions would also help create additional functions for the app, such as profiles, statistics, and goals, which could be used to fill out the back end of the app.
Without the use of personalized, the app presents more as a video player rather than a fitness app.
| Who Is Gaiam TV Best For?
Gaiam TV Fit & Yoga is best for users 16+ years of age who want high-quality home workouts where ever they go. Presented by some of the biggest names in fitness, Gaiam TV’s video content is clear and informative.
However, the app’s lack of content and depth is noticeable with many tabs appearing empty. This is a reflection of no user profile, goal setting functions and overall personalization.
While there is some good content within the app, its lack of functionality makes it feel like a fitness streaming platform, rather than a fitness app, potentially losing users to more complete platforms on the market.
